    Operational Controlling Manager

    This Hybrid position is direct hire with a reputable, financially strong, Global Tier 1 Automotive Supplier located in the US HQ in Troy, overseeing the financial controls for 6 automotive manufacturing facilities. You would have direct reports of a Controller and Cost Accountant at each facility. Focus will be on Management Accounting, Controls of General and Cost Accounting, Internal Auditing, Budgeting, Inventory Valuation, Standard Costing, Bill of Material, Routing, Efficiency Variances, and Price Variances which would enable sound business decisions to be made for current and future growth objectives.

    Primary Responsibilities:

    • To ensure all financial controls are in place for 6 manufacturing facilities in the US as it pertains to general property, cost accounting, internal auditing, and budgeting to enable company to meet current goals and objectives as well as make sound business decisions regarding future growth.
    • Work with Plant Management team on ongoing and new business issues to ensure accuracy of financial statement information
    • Work with Accounting group to communicate plant related issues and provide direction on plant financial performance
    • Manage Plant Controlling organization to ensure compliance with controlling guidelines
    • Participate in all plant level management meetings and provide guidance to Plant Management team on all financial related matters
    • Provide plant management team with periodic analysis of plant financial results
    • Manage budget process at plant level including analysis of year over year changes
    • Oversee forecast process at plant level
    • Manages month end process and target actual analysis
    • Ensures all reporting requirements are met timely and accurately
    • Work with Plant Management team on strengthening internal controls at the plant level
    • Work with Plant Management team on improving core manufacturing systems including inventory, labor reporting and tracking, overtime tracking, scrap reporting, and shipping
    • Work with Plant Management team and Corporate Engineering group on launch of new programs
    • Work with Fixed Asset accountant to ensure accuracy of capital for plants
    • Key contact for all financial related matters by Plant Management team at the plant level
    • Participate in working with IT in developing or identifying procedures/software systems and makes recommendations that will continually enhance company financial operations or respond to changing conditions
    • Maintains positive employee relations and addresses issues in timely manner. Seeks advice/counsel from appropriate sources as required. Conducts timely annual performance reviews
